The Importance of Emotional Resilience

Tyler’s passing is a stark reminder of the importance of emotional resilience in trading. The ability to cope with losses and setbacks is vital for anyone involved in the financial markets. Traders often face periods of drawdowns, and how they handle these situations can significantly impact their overall success.

Developing emotional resilience involves recognizing the psychological aspects of trading and learning to manage emotions effectively. This can include strategies such as maintaining a trading journal, setting realistic goals, and practicing mindfulness techniques. By building emotional strength, traders can better navigate the ups and downs of the market, reducing the risk of becoming overwhelmed by losses.

Taking care of your mental health while trading

In light of Tyler’s passing, it’s a good time to emphasize the importance of mental health in trading. The pressure to succeed can lead to stress, anxiety, and even depression. It’s essential to prioritize your mental well-being. Here are a few tips to keep in mind:

1. **Set Realistic Goals**: Don’t put unnecessary pressure on yourself to achieve massive returns overnight. Set achievable goals that allow for gradual growth.

2. **Take Breaks**: Step away from the screens. Regular breaks can clear your mind and help you return to trading with a fresh perspective.

3. **Connect with Others**: Engage with the trading community. Share your experiences and challenges. Sometimes, just talking to someone who understands can make a world of difference.

4. **Practice Mindfulness**: Techniques like meditation or yoga can help manage stress and improve focus. Consider incorporating these into your daily routine.

5. **Seek Professional Help**: If you find yourself struggling, don’t hesitate to seek help from a mental health professional. It’s a sign of strength, not weakness.
